How to fill out kentucky self-proving affidavit form

Illustration

How to fill out kentucky self-proving affidavit form

01
Step 1: Obtain the Kentucky self-proving affidavit form. This form can be found on the website of the Kentucky Court of Justice or obtained from a legal document provider.
02
Step 2: Read the instructions carefully to understand the requirements and purpose of the self-proving affidavit.
03
Step 3: Gather all the necessary information and documents that are needed to fill out the form. This may include personal details of the testator (person making the will) and witnesses.
04
Step 4: Fill out the form accurately and completely. Provide the required information in the designated fields, such as names, addresses, and signatures.
05
Step 5: Review the completed form for any errors or omissions. Make sure all the information is correct and properly filled.
06
Step 6: Sign the self-proving affidavit in the presence of a notary public. The witnesses may also need to sign the form in the presence of the notary public.
07
Step 7: File the self-proving affidavit along with the last will and testament document with the appropriate court or keep it in a safe place. It is recommended to make copies for personal records as well.
08
Step 8: Seek legal advice or consultation if you have any questions or concerns regarding the self-proving affidavit or the will in general.

Who needs kentucky self-proving affidavit form?

01
Anyone who wants to ensure the validity and authenticity of their last will and testament in Kentucky may need a self-proving affidavit form. This form is typically used when creating a will to provide additional evidence and documentation to support the will's legitimacy. It is particularly important for individuals who anticipate potential disputes or challenges to their will after their death.

Kentucky self-proving affidavit form is a legal document that allows a will to be probated without the need for witnesses to appear in court to validate the will.
The person creating the will, also known as the testator, is required to fill out and file the Kentucky self-proving affidavit form.
To fill out the Kentucky self-proving affidavit form, the testator must complete the required fields, sign the document in front of a notary public, and have the witnesses sign the form as well.
The purpose of the Kentucky self-proving affidavit form is to streamline the probate process by having the required witnesses verify the authenticity of the will at the time of creation.
The Kentucky self-proving affidavit form must include the names and signatures of the testator and witnesses, along with the date the will was signed.
